Uiwebview memory leak pdf file download

Memory leak with uiwebview memory, uiwebview,dealloc my project is a hybrid static lib for showing a uiwebview with some js to control the logic. Id very easy to load pdf file uiwebview using xcode 8. Click download file button or copy bb real book 6th edition pdf url which shown in textarea when you clicked file title, and paste it into your browsers address bar. I have adobe acrobat pro xi on 10 of my users desktops and as soon as 9390290. I have a problem using uiwebview in my application. You can use the webviews navigating event to test if the uri being navigated to, is your pdf link.

This question is about an ios app with an integrated uiwebview. I am passing url in webview and it contains typefile attribute in many places to upload files like images, videos, doc, pdf, ppt, excel. Cocoa and cocoa touch are the environments used to define apps that run in macos, ios, tvos, and watchos. Jun 25, 2011 i am creating the pdf file based on the the input from the user. It seems like each time readium loads a new spine item into the uiwebview there is a growth in webc. Pages are created the exact same way they would be if the user printed the content on an ios device very similar as well as os x print output. You can now include a webview widget in your widget tree.

When i use 64bit and run demo on ios 8iphone 6, the memory keeps going to 30m or more. You can set it to true in your code or in the uibuilder. The user need to enter username and password, so they can see a web site with a download link to download a zip file. Then again hopefully imperfections will be resolved in time. Now, if you run your application and do nothing with your qwebview widget, then there wont be any memory leak as expected. Theres a property on the uiwebview called scalespagetofit. Customizing uiwebview for pdfs in swift atomic spin. Is there a way to download the pdf locally instead of opening inside webview.

Jun 17, 2010 rendering pdf is easier than you thought jun 17, 2010 we all know by now that adobe is almost as evil as, well lets say they pioneered a couple of functionalities that where great for the longest time. Hacking and securing next generation iphone and ipad apps. Uploading files uiwebview xamarin community forums. We use cookies for various purposes including analytics. On the simulator its ok but on devices have memory leak. Having tested it with image laden web pages containing complex javascript, it performed well.

If it is, then simply download the file within your apps code and cancel the webviews navigation. My first blog post on iphone subject reveal a big memory bug when using uiwebview component. I have observed serious memory leaks related to web caching in 2. Im writing an ios application using the readium sdk and associated jshtmlcss and i started having issues with memory pressure. Ive had people tell me i look like edward snowden, but i promise you i am not him, but with all the satellites flying overhead, they may be all out to get us. Im showing a list uitableview of places and when the user tap a place, i show a uiwebview with some website related with this place. Try not to leak data to 3rd party analytics services. Uiwebview causing memory warning hello, im working on an app in which im showing websites through uiwebview, but this is causing memory warning and my app is crashed after few secs. Uiwebview file chooser issue in ios 9 apple developer forums. Download a pdf through website using a webview and save it.

Using uiwebview for displaying rich text kiefermat. Code uiwebview memory leak prevention coder cowboy. Contribute to tracy euiwebviewtofile development by creating an account on github. Oct 24, 2016 customizing how the pdf is scaled default behavior. Rendering pdf is easier than you thought cocoanetics. After i wake up in the morning most of my apps are suspended save for 34 of them so definitely there is something wrong. I performed stress testing and found that the cache used by nsurlrequest will leak memory no matter what. How to download a pdf from uiwebview apple developer forums.

Memory leak warning when using qwebviewseturl in debug builds. As the input changes, the pdf should display this change. Uiwebview causing memory warning treehouse community. How to properly remove an instance of uiwebview and avoid. Powenko, ios tutorial 105,ebook, pdf, powenko, ios tutorial 80, custom ui, mtstatusbaroverlay powenko, ios tutorial,lib, 10 ios libraries to make your life easier. Browse other questions tagged ios pdf memory leaks uiwebview or ask your own question. Memory leak in wkwebview instantiation ios questions. I am getting an out of memory error when redacting a pdf.

How to properly remove an instance of uiwebview and avoid memory leaks destroywebview. The application starts to download a 90mb db with pouchdb from a couchdb server. A memory leak is a piece of allocated memory that nothing points to. One of the serverloaded pages presented in the uiwebview is a file chooser, similar to. Sometimes sitecore mobile sdk uiwebview can be crashed when memory warning happens. Form, and the input type file acceptimage works perfectly it will open up a dialog with various options. I have an app where we are using uiwebview to show html content. Apple disclaims any and all liability for the acts, omissions and conduct of any third parties in connection with or related to your use of the site. Jpeg exception is occurring when trying to add 8 bpp jpg to pdf. Pdf to pdfa conversion time and output file size issue. I have a viewcontroller which contains wkwebview when i pop it from the navigation controller i get memory leak. This is the only one component to display some html content in an iphone interface.

I get the updated data, at first it displays always the previous data then only when i click the pdf generation button again does it update to the changed data. That page has links to pdf and upon touch the pdf is opening inside uiwebview. Im the web technologys evangelist for safari and webkit. Webview input typefile not working xamarin community forums.

Uiwebview secrets part1 memory leaks on xmlrequest. Wkwebview does not leak and has a much smaller memory footprint than uiwebview. The keys associated with the cocoa environments provide support for interface builder nib files and provide support for other userfacing features vended by your bundle. In order to talk about how memory leaks occur, how to. If you set it to true, the pdf will start off scaled so that its width fills the width of the view. Accelerometer open several web pages with accelerometers. This site contains user submitted content, comments and opinions and is for informational purposes only. He works on enterprise infrastructure for big companies. Download batch tiff pdf resizer a small, yet reliable and efficient piece of software designed to convert and resize single and multipage tiff images to pdf, jpg or tiff formats.

By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Using the uiwebview for displaying rich text is not difficult when keeping in mind, that you are actually using a full web browser. Aug 02, 2012 hi alex, i am trying to upload a file using icab mobile browser but not able to do so. I am really wondering what causes this and how to fix this. However, if you use the seturl method to open a web page, then upon leaving your application, you will see some memory leaks in the application output window when running from qt creator. The same caching code seems to be used by uiwebview. Uiwebview object has pixelstech, this page is to provide vistors information of the most updated technology information around the world.

Optimizing web content in your app wwdc 2016 apple developer. Uniwebview integrating webview to your mobile games in a simple way. If you set a delegate to the uiwebview, do not forget to set it to nil before releasing it, e. He also enjoys creating smaller scale software products and scripts in his spare time.

135 1295 463 1396 374 1208 881 800 188 198 241 1496 342 545 491 1398 607 1107 229 681 333 1359 826 884 981 945 1535 731 1391 164 303 17 303 1188 630 1392 35 1113 990